Output 5e351af911c6e16dbea07ba7c4097190363025ae360f3d31eb77e1e1e4faf417:0

value
308678384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8663c0a285c004bc55e30d3f95839fc0aeb4927675875e92106224b479ac5c7d
address
tb1pse3upg59cqztc40rp5letqulczhtfynkwkr4ayssvgjtg7dvt37svkc5fp
transaction
5e351af911c6e16dbea07ba7c4097190363025ae360f3d31eb77e1e1e4faf417
confirmations
81718
spent
true